Mayvin Inc. - Internship Program

USAFUSAUSCGUSMCUSNUSSF🔒 Secret requiredU.S. citizenship
Program summary

The Subject Matter Expert (SME) Principal is a consummate Acquisition Professional, supporting an Assistant Program Manager (APM) and the commodity team to deliver outstanding Program Management services to DoD customers and stakeholders. The SETA provides this support across both Acquisition and Technical subject areas.

Roles & job description

As a Subject Matter Expert (SME) Principal you will learn the functionalities of and perform the following duties inclusive but not limited to: 1. Acquisition and Procurement: Understand Federal Acquisition Regulations (FAR) and Defense Federal Acquisition Regulation Supplement (DFARS). Prepare and review acquisition documentation, including Statement of Objectives (SOOs), Statement of Work (SOW) requirements, procurement plans, program descriptions, and technical specifications. Assist in the development of procurement strategies. 2. RFP Review and Evaluation: Review Request for Proposal (RFP) packages for compliance with procurement regulations. Evaluate technical aspects of RFPs. Validate Independent Government Cost Estimates (IGCEs). 3. Vendor and Product Evaluation: Evaluate vendor/acquisition contractor proposals. Analyze Commercial Off-The-Shelf (COTS) and Government Off-The-Shelf (GOTS) products for suitability. Contribute to source selection decisions.

Interview prep for this program
Ask them
  • ▸ "How many of your past SkillBridge interns received full-time offers?" — a serious program knows the number.
  • ▸ "Who will my day-to-day mentor be, and what does week one look like?"
  • ▸ "The listing says 121 - 150 days — can that flex to my approved window if my command shortens it?"
  • ▸ "Is relocation expected for a full-time offer, or can I convert where I am?"
  • ▸ Confirm the eligibility notes above — ask exactly what they need from you and when.
